Thursday, February 9, 2012 – Ride at Dupuis

Despite setting the alarm, due to some complications we didn’t get going until fairly late in the morning, but we had decided to trailer the horses over to one of our favorite places to ride, Dupuis Wildlife Management Area near Indiantown, FL. The horses nickered when they saw the trailer, obviously they were ready for a change of scene as well! After the half hour drive, we got the horses saddled up and going by about 1:15. What a great ride! We love this place, it has so many trails that all offer something incredible. We started out on the Green trail, going in a direction we’d never been before, and it seems that they trails have been re-marked fairly recently, as we had no trouble reading any of the markings, and never lost our way, even for a minute! Trails here have great footing, hardly any water or flooding despite all the rain we had earlier in the week, we just rode and rode and rode. Lots of jogging and trotting, and several great canters as well. It even seemed like the horses were more comfortable with their new hoof trim, they seemed to stumble a bit less than usual and just overall seemed more comfortable on their feet, which was terrific!
